In the sequel to Kingdom Come: Deliverance, Side Missions manifest in diverse forms and challenging tiers, often connected to major game objectives or offering insights into the whereabouts of vital characters. Additionally, these side missions can aid players in making wiser decisions at critical junctures known as Points of No Return.
Even though completing Secondary Quests isn’t essential for enjoying this adventure in KCD2, they offer numerous intriguing rewards (such as reputation points, skill experience, and Groschen), and they can also unlock other crucial Sub-Quests that help Henry enhance his combat or crafting abilities. Players should bear in mind that many Side Missions yield varying results based on Henry’s actions. For instance, the Sheep Among Wolves mission awards players with additional Groschen and Survival Experience if they successfully preserve the Sheep Decoy and protect the rest of the flock from wolves.

In this game, tasks differ slightly from secondary quests; they may be shorter or follow a sequence. For instance, in the Birds of Prey mission, players are assigned to eliminate multiple Poachers from the Semine and Trosky forests. Gradually, they’ll discover that the elusive Poacher known as The Ghost is actually Hans Capon, who has been surviving by doing what he does best.

Be aware that once you pass certain critical points (known as Points of No Return), some side missions and tasks may become unavailable. For instance, the Bandit Hunt series initiated by Canker could be inaccessible if you proceed to capture the rebel son of Lord Semine at Semine Castle. Therefore, ensure you complete all objectives prior to reaching these points, as this reduces the risk of missing out on exciting rewards.
